What Causes Bicycle Accidents in Bay Ridge?
Bay Ridge is a popular area for cyclists, but navigating its busy streets and intersections can pose serious risks. Many bicycle accidents are avoidable and happen because someone failed to act responsibly. Common contributing factors include:
- Driver Distraction: Motorists looking at phones or GPS systems often overlook nearby cyclists, especially on narrow roads or near intersections.
- Sudden Door Openings: Parked vehicles along 3rd or 5th Avenue can pose a threat when drivers open doors without checking for passing cyclists.
- Poor Road Conditions: Uneven surfaces, debris, and potholes along Shore Road or residential blocks can easily cause a rider to crash.
- Right-of-Way Violations: Drivers making turns or running stop signs without yielding to cyclists often cause dangerous collisions.
- Blocked Bike Paths: Illegally parked vehicles or construction zones can force cyclists into traffic, increasing the risk of being struck.

Common Injuries from Bicycle Crashes in Bay Ridge
Cyclists riding through Bay Ridge face constant exposure to vehicles, uneven roads, and distracted drivers—leaving them vulnerable in a collision. Without the protection that car passengers have, even a low-speed impact can result in serious injury. Here are some of the most frequent injuries sustained in local bicycle accidents:
- Traumatic Brain Injuries: Even when wearing a helmet, riders can suffer head trauma that affects memory, mood, and concentration.
- Bone Fractures: Falls or collisions often lead to broken wrists, arms, legs, or hips—sometimes requiring surgery and months of recovery.
- Back and Neck Injuries: Spinal damage and soft tissue injuries can lead to long-term mobility problems or chronic discomfort.
- Skin Damage: Sliding across pavement can cause road rash and deep wounds that may require medical procedures and leave permanent scars.
- Internal Trauma: Forceful impacts can damage internal organs or cause internal bleeding, which may not be obvious right away but can be life-threatening without prompt care.

Understanding Your Rights as a Cyclist in Bay Ridge
Bay Ridge cyclists are protected by city and state traffic laws that recognize bikes as vehicles with the same rights and responsibilities as motorists. When drivers or property owners fail to respect those rights, injured riders have legal options. Here’s what every Bay Ridge bicyclist should know after a crash:
- Equal Road Access: Cyclists have the legal right to share the road with motor vehicles and should not be forced off the street by aggressive or inattentive drivers.
- Right to Safe Bike Lanes: Motorists are prohibited from blocking or driving in designated bike lanes. If your crash occurred due to a blocked lane, the driver may be liable.
- Safe Passing Laws: Drivers must leave ample space when overtaking cyclists. Failing to do so can lead to dangerous collisions and legal consequences.
- Responsibility for Dangerous Driving: Speeding, failing to yield, or opening a car door without checking for bikes are all forms of negligence that can make a driver legally responsible.
- City Liability for Road Hazards: If cracked pavement, missing signage, or other hazards maintained by the city caused your fall, you may have a claim against a government agency.
- Partial Fault Doesn’t Prevent a Claim: Even if you made a mistake while riding, New York’s comparative fault laws mean you can still pursue damages. Any award would simply reflect your percentage of responsibility.

What Should I Do If the Driver Claims I Was at Fault for the Accident?
If the driver claims that you were at fault, it’s important to remain calm and avoid making any admissions. The police report and witness statements will play a key role in determining fault. An experienced bicycle accident lawyer can review the evidence and fight to prove your case. New York’s comparative negligence law allows you to recover compensation even if you are partially at fault, though your compensation may be reduced based on your percentage of fault.
Can I Still Recover Compensation If I Wasn’t Wearing a Helmet?
Yes, you can still recover compensation even if you weren’t wearing a helmet at the time of the accident. However, the defense may argue that your injuries could have been less severe if you had worn one. A skilled lawyer can help counter these arguments and work to secure the compensation you deserve for your injuries.
How Long Do I Have to File a Bicycle Accident Lawsuit in NYC?
In New York,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ury lawsuit, including bicycle accidents, is generally three years from the date of the accident. However, certain circumstances may affect this timeline, so it’s important to consult with a lawyer as soon as possible to protect your rights and avoid missing critical deadlines.
